Train, supervise and work with all kitchen staff in order to prepare, cook and present food according to hotel standard recipes to create quality food products. Summary of Essential Job Functions * Assign, in detail, specific duties to all associates under supervision for efficient operation of kitchen.
* Assist the Executive Chef with personnel functions as directed, e.g. interviewing, training, performance evaluations, resolving problems, providing open communication and recommending discipline and/or termination when appropriate.
* Train and supervise kitchen staff in the proper preparation of menu items.
* Schedule culinary staff so that proper coverage is maintained while keeping payroll costs in line.
* Communicate both verbally and in writing to provide clear direction to staff.
* Ensure proper receiving, storage (including temperature-setting) and rotation of food products so as to comply with health department regulations.
* Adhere to control procedures for cost and quality.
* Comply with attendance rules and be available to work on a regular basis.
* Perform any other job-related duties as assigned.
